Best Colorado Private Elementary Schools Belonging To National Lutheran Schools Accreditation (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 3 private elementary schools belonging to national lutheran schools accreditation serving 703 students in Colorado. You can also find more schools membership associations in Colorado.
The best top ranked belonging to national lutheran schools accreditation private elementary schools in Colorado include Bethlehem Lutheran School and St. John's Lutheran School.
The average acceptance rate is 95%, which is higher than the Colorado private elementary school average acceptance rate of 89%.
100% of private elementary schools belonging to national lutheran schools accreditation in Colorado are religiously affiliated (most commonly Lutheran Church Missouri Synod).
